SlideShare uma empresa Scribd logo
1 de 14
Baixar para ler offline
UNIVERSIDAD TÉCNICA DE AMBATO
 
    FACULTAD DE INGENIERÍA CIVIL Y MECÁNICA
 
          CARRERA DE INGENIERÍA CIVIL
 
              EMPLEO DE NTIC´S II
 
INTEGRANTES:Byron Guashca
 
      TEMA:LÓGICA DE PROGRAMACIÓN
           SEMESTRE SEGUNDO
               PARALELO”D”
             FECHA:12-03-2012
                                               
ÍNDICE
1. Carátula
2. Índice
3. Objetivos
4. Resumen
5. Desarrollo
• Pasos para la resolución de un problema por computador.
• Definición y delimitación del problema.
• Análisis del problema
• Diseño del algoritmo
• Codificación
• Compilación
• Depuración
• La documentación
• Ejecución
• Mantenimiento
6. Conclusiones
7. Bibliografía
 
 
OBJETIVOS
 
● Determinar los pasos para la solución de
  un problema por computador.
● Comprender las diferentes formas de
  representar un algoritmo identificado la
  mejor al momento de dar solución a un
  problema.
 
 
RESUMEN
 
En esta presentación se da a conocer los pasos para
desarrollar un programa por computador entre estos
tenemos:
 
• Definición y delimitación
• Análisis del Problema
• Diseño del Algoritmo
• Codificación
• Compilación
• Depuración
• La documentación
• Ejecución
• Mantenimiento
 
 
DESARROLLO


                DEFINICIÒN Y DELIMITACIÒN DEL
                PROBLEMA




                                                No
     El enunciado                               confundir el
                          Esta dad por          enunciado
     del problema




                        Requerimientos del
                        problema
ANÁLISIS DEL PROBLEMA
            ANÀLISIS DEL
             PROBLEMA




             DEFINIR
             LOS:




 Datos de   Datos de       Cálculos y
 entrada    salida         fórmulas
DISEÑO DEL ALGORITMO
                       DISEÑO DEL ALGORITMO




   DETERMINA:                                   DEPENDE EL:




         El orden   La manera
Los      lógico     como se             Éxito                 Fracaso
pasos    de         desarrolla
         ejecució   todo el
         n          programa                       La
                                                   solución
                                                   a un
                                                   problema
CODIFICACIÓN
                      Se escribe la
                      solución del
                      problema




Diseño del                                       Código fuente
algoritmo    Basado   CODIFICACIÒN    Conocido



                            Se
                            escribe




                       Lenguaje de
                       programación
COMPILACIÓN
          COMPILACIÒN



               Revisión de
                    las
              instrucciones
                    del
              programador



                              La gramática
              Teniendo en     esté escrita
              cuenta que:     correctamente
DEPURACIÓN
                       DEPURACIÒN



  Después que el                    Se da paso al
  compilador detecte                depurador que de la
  los errores                       solución al problema
                                    sin ninguna falla




   Ayuda a
   comprender el                      Y facilita las
   programa                           modificaciones
LA DOCUMENTACIÓN
                          Comentarios
                          que se
              INTERNA     añaden al
                          código




LA
DOCUMENTACI
                        Documento con
ÒN
                        la descripción del
                        problema, autor,
                        algoritmo,
              EXTERN    diccionario de
              A         datos, código
                        fuente.
EJECUCIÓN
                     EJECUCIÓN

                                   Se ejecuta para ver los
                                   resultados, utilizando
                                   dispositivos de :


Efectividad de un
algoritmo se
compara los
requerimientos con
soluciones                       ENTRADA         SALIDA
MANTENIMIENTO

                MANTENIMIENTO


                Después de terminar
                el programa, para
                hacer



                                      Complementación
 Algún cambio       Algún ajuste
                                      al programa
Conclusiones
● Los pasos para la solución de un
   problema por computador son:
Definición y delimitación del problema,
Análisis del problema, Diseño del
algoritmo, Depuración, Compilación,
Codificación, Documentación, Ejecución y
Mantenimiento.

Mais conteúdo relacionado

Mais procurados

Pasos para la solucion de un problema
Pasos para la solucion de un problemaPasos para la solucion de un problema
Pasos para la solucion de un problemakennyq12
 
Tarea 4
Tarea 4Tarea 4
Tarea 4cobacd
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orgisseparrav
 
presentaciones dropbox
presentaciones dropboxpresentaciones dropbox
presentaciones dropboxalcoseromar
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orMarvigs89
 
Pasos Para Resolver Un Problema Utilizando Un Pc
Pasos  Para Resolver Un Problema  Utilizando Un PcPasos  Para Resolver Un Problema  Utilizando Un Pc
Pasos Para Resolver Un Problema Utilizando Un Pcguest965b17
 
Solucion de problemas por medio de computadoras
Solucion de problemas por medio de computadorasSolucion de problemas por medio de computadoras
Solucion de problemas por medio de computadorasJorge Ñauñay
 
Tarea de completar tello
Tarea de completar telloTarea de completar tello
Tarea de completar tellocesarcunalata
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computadoreduardzavala93
 
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MAS
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MASMETOD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MAS
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MASadark
 
Metodología para la solución de un problema
Metodología para la solución de un problemaMetodología para la solución de un problema
Metodología para la solución de un problemaIEO Santo Tomás
 

Mais procurados (15)

Pasos para la solucion de un problema
Pasos para la solucion de un problemaPasos para la solucion de un problema
Pasos para la solucion de un problema
 
Tarea 4
Tarea 4Tarea 4
Tarea 4
 
Tarea 4
Tarea 4Tarea 4
Tarea 4
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computador
 
presentaciones dropbox
presentaciones dropboxpresentaciones dropbox
presentaciones dropbox
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computador
 
Pasos Para Resolver Un Problema Utilizando Un Pc
Pasos  Para Resolver Un Problema  Utilizando Un PcPasos  Para Resolver Un Problema  Utilizando Un Pc
Pasos Para Resolver Un Problema Utilizando Un Pc
 
Solucion de problemas por medio de computadoras
Solucion de problemas por medio de computadorasSolucion de problemas por medio de computadoras
Solucion de problemas por medio de computadoras
 
Tarea de completar tello
Tarea de completar telloTarea de completar tello
Tarea de completar tello
 
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computador
 
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MAS
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MASMETOD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MAS
METODOLOGÍA PARA LA SOLUCIÓN DE PROBLEMAS
 
Tarea 4
Tarea 4Tarea 4
Tarea 4
 
Fases de resolución de un problema
Fases de resolución de un problemaFases de resolución de un problema
Fases de resolución de un problema
 
Método de las 6 d
Método de las 6 dMétodo de las 6 d
Método de las 6 d
 
Metodología para la solución de un problema
Metodología para la solución de un problemaMetodología para la solución de un problema
Metodología para la solución de un problema
 

Destaque

Muhammad fahmi usman keamanan sistem jaringan komputer
Muhammad fahmi usman keamanan sistem jaringan komputerMuhammad fahmi usman keamanan sistem jaringan komputer
Muhammad fahmi usman keamanan sistem jaringan komputerArLhi
 
AdobeCustomCertificate_illustrator2
AdobeCustomCertificate_illustrator2AdobeCustomCertificate_illustrator2
AdobeCustomCertificate_illustrator2Francesca Bazzani
 
portfolio-illustrations
portfolio-illustrationsportfolio-illustrations
portfolio-illustrationsTonia Kouzou
 
La placa base y sus elementos
La placa base y sus elementosLa placa base y sus elementos
La placa base y sus elementoshellosis
 
Actualización de competencias y estándares TIC en la profesión docente
Actualización de competencias  y estándares TIC en la profesión docenteActualización de competencias  y estándares TIC en la profesión docente
Actualización de competencias y estándares TIC en la profesión docenteSofia Arevalo Rojas
 
Bruno Quick Lei Geral
Bruno Quick Lei GeralBruno Quick Lei Geral
Bruno Quick Lei GeralSEBRAE MS
 
Academic reference for GESIKA JORGENSEN
Academic reference for GESIKA JORGENSENAcademic reference for GESIKA JORGENSEN
Academic reference for GESIKA JORGENSENGesika Jørgensen
 
Comunicación interactiva
Comunicación  interactivaComunicación  interactiva
Comunicación interactivaFrancysPerez
 
Ponencia vic llengua i continguts
Ponencia vic llengua i contingutsPonencia vic llengua i continguts
Ponencia vic llengua i contingutsÀngels Candela
 

Destaque (20)

Actividad 5
Actividad 5Actividad 5
Actividad 5
 
Muhammad fahmi usman keamanan sistem jaringan komputer
Muhammad fahmi usman keamanan sistem jaringan komputerMuhammad fahmi usman keamanan sistem jaringan komputer
Muhammad fahmi usman keamanan sistem jaringan komputer
 
Gestion etica 1
Gestion etica 1Gestion etica 1
Gestion etica 1
 
CV_Jeeshan CPE
CV_Jeeshan CPECV_Jeeshan CPE
CV_Jeeshan CPE
 
La depresión
La depresiónLa depresión
La depresión
 
AdobeCustomCertificate_illustrator2
AdobeCustomCertificate_illustrator2AdobeCustomCertificate_illustrator2
AdobeCustomCertificate_illustrator2
 
Ambiente familiar
Ambiente familiarAmbiente familiar
Ambiente familiar
 
Actividad 7
Actividad 7Actividad 7
Actividad 7
 
De raiz
De raizDe raiz
De raiz
 
Què es un blog
Què es un blogQuè es un blog
Què es un blog
 
portfolio-illustrations
portfolio-illustrationsportfolio-illustrations
portfolio-illustrations
 
El desarrollo tecnologico
El desarrollo tecnologicoEl desarrollo tecnologico
El desarrollo tecnologico
 
Gruppe 4
Gruppe 4Gruppe 4
Gruppe 4
 
La placa base y sus elementos
La placa base y sus elementosLa placa base y sus elementos
La placa base y sus elementos
 
Actualización de competencias y estándares TIC en la profesión docente
Actualización de competencias  y estándares TIC en la profesión docenteActualización de competencias  y estándares TIC en la profesión docente
Actualización de competencias y estándares TIC en la profesión docente
 
Bruno Quick Lei Geral
Bruno Quick Lei GeralBruno Quick Lei Geral
Bruno Quick Lei Geral
 
Academic reference for GESIKA JORGENSEN
Academic reference for GESIKA JORGENSENAcademic reference for GESIKA JORGENSEN
Academic reference for GESIKA JORGENSEN
 
Feel
FeelFeel
Feel
 
Comunicación interactiva
Comunicación  interactivaComunicación  interactiva
Comunicación interactiva
 
Ponencia vic llengua i continguts
Ponencia vic llengua i contingutsPonencia vic llengua i continguts
Ponencia vic llengua i continguts
 

Semelhante a Tarea 4 (20)

Pasos para la solución de un problema por computador
Pasos para la solución de un problema por computadorPasos para la solución de un problema por computador
Pasos para la solución de un problema por computador
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 
PRESENTACION
PRESENTACIONPRESENTACION
PRESENTACION
 

Tarea 4

  • 1. UNIVERSIDAD TÉCNICA DE AMBATO   FACULTAD DE INGENIERÍA CIVIL Y MECÁNICA   CARRERA DE INGENIERÍA CIVIL   EMPLEO DE NTIC´S II   INTEGRANTES:Byron Guashca   TEMA:LÓGICA DE PROGRAMACIÓN SEMESTRE SEGUNDO PARALELO”D” FECHA:12-03-2012  
  • 2. ÍNDICE 1. Carátula 2. Índice 3. Objetivos 4. Resumen 5. Desarrollo • Pasos para la resolución de un problema por computador. • Definición y delimitación del problema. • Análisis del problema • Diseño del algoritmo • Codificación • Compilación • Depuración • La documentación • Ejecución • Mantenimiento 6. Conclusiones 7. Bibliografía    
  • 3. OBJETIVOS   ● Determinar los pasos para la solución de un problema por computador. ● Comprender las diferentes formas de representar un algoritmo identificado la mejor al momento de dar solución a un problema.    
  • 4. RESUMEN   En esta presentación se da a conocer los pasos para desarrollar un programa por computador entre estos tenemos:   • Definición y delimitación • Análisis del Problema • Diseño del Algoritmo • Codificación • Compilación • Depuración • La documentación • Ejecución • Mantenimiento    
  • 5. DESARROLLO DEFINICIÒN Y DELIMITACIÒN DEL PROBLEMA No El enunciado confundir el Esta dad por enunciado del problema Requerimientos del problema
  • 6. ANÁLISIS DEL PROBLEMA ANÀLISIS DEL PROBLEMA DEFINIR LOS: Datos de Datos de Cálculos y entrada salida fórmulas
  • 7. DISEÑO DEL ALGORITMO DISEÑO DEL ALGORITMO DETERMINA: DEPENDE EL: El orden La manera Los lógico como se Éxito Fracaso pasos de desarrolla ejecució todo el n programa La solución a un problema
  • 8. CODIFICACIÓN Se escribe la solución del problema Diseño del Código fuente algoritmo Basado CODIFICACIÒN Conocido Se escribe Lenguaje de programación
  • 9. COMPILACIÓN COMPILACIÒN Revisión de las instrucciones del programador La gramática Teniendo en esté escrita cuenta que: correctamente
  • 10. DEPURACIÓN DEPURACIÒN Después que el Se da paso al compilador detecte depurador que de la los errores solución al problema sin ninguna falla Ayuda a comprender el Y facilita las programa modificaciones
  • 11. LA DOCUMENTACIÓN Comentarios que se INTERNA añaden al código LA DOCUMENTACI Documento con ÒN la descripción del problema, autor, algoritmo, EXTERN diccionario de A datos, código fuente.
  • 12. EJECUCIÓN EJECUCIÓN Se ejecuta para ver los resultados, utilizando dispositivos de : Efectividad de un algoritmo se compara los requerimientos con soluciones ENTRADA SALIDA
  • 13. MANTENIMIENTO MANTENIMIENTO Después de terminar el programa, para hacer Complementación Algún cambio Algún ajuste al programa
  • 14. Conclusiones ● Los pasos para la solución de un problema por computador son: Definición y delimitación del problema, Análisis del problema, Diseño del algoritmo, Depuración, Compilación, Codificación, Documentación, Ejecución y Mantenimiento.